如何在GitHub上下载二进制文件

在现代软件开发中,GitHub作为一个重要的代码托管平台,不仅支持源代码管理,也支持二进制文件的存储和下载。二进制文件是已经编译的程序或库,通常用于部署或分发软件。本文将详细介绍如何在GitHub上下载二进制文件,包括相关步骤、常见问题以及一些最佳实践。

什么是二进制文件?

在软件开发中,二进制文件指的是经过编译后的可执行程序或库。与源代码相比,二进制文件更为紧凑且易于分发,适合直接在目标环境中运行。常见的二进制文件格式包括:

  • .exe – Windows可执行文件
  • .dll – 动态链接库
  • .so – Linux共享对象文件
  • .dmg – macOS磁盘映像文件

为什么需要在GitHub上下载二进制文件?

在GitHub上,许多开源项目提供了可直接下载的二进制文件,方便用户无需编译即可使用。这样做的优点包括:

  • 简化用户体验:用户不需要具备编译源代码的技术能力。
  • 提高软件可用性:快速获得可以直接运行的版本。
  • 社区支持:许多开源项目会维护最新的二进制文件,以方便用户下载。

如何在GitHub上下载二进制文件?

在GitHub上下载二进制文件的步骤非常简单。以下是详细的操作流程:

第一步:访问项目页面

  1. 打开您的浏览器,访问目标项目的GitHub页面。
  2. 查找项目的主页面,通常为 https://github.com/username/repository

第二步:找到Releases页面

  1. 在项目的主页面中,找到并点击“Releases”选项卡。
  2. 这个选项卡通常位于页面的右侧或者下方。

第三步:选择版本

  1. 在Releases页面中,您会看到各个版本的列表。
  2. 找到您需要的版本,点击相应的标签或版本号。

第四步:下载二进制文件

  1. 在版本详情页中,查找与二进制文件相关的链接。
  2. 这些链接通常以文件名结尾,例如 .exe.tar.gz 等。
  3. 点击所需文件链接,文件将开始下载。

示例

假设您要下载一个名为“example-project”的项目的二进制文件:

  • 访问 https://github.com/username/example-project
  • 点击“Releases”,选择一个版本。
  • 下载相应的二进制文件。

常见问题解答(FAQ)

如何确定下载的二进制文件是安全的?

  • 检查项目的信誉:查看项目的Stars和Fork数量,判断其受欢迎程度。
  • 阅读评论和文档:查看其他用户的反馈和使用体验。
  • 使用数字签名:有些项目会提供二进制文件的数字签名以确保文件的完整性。

如果在下载过程中遇到问题怎么办?

  • 检查网络连接:确保您的互联网连接正常。
  • 清除浏览器缓存:有时,浏览器缓存可能导致下载失败。
  • 尝试不同的浏览器:不同的浏览器可能会影响下载体验。

GitHub是否支持大文件下载?

是的,GitHub通过其Git Large File Storage (LFS)扩展支持大文件的存储和管理。对于需要下载的大文件,确保您已安装Git LFS,并按照相关指引进行操作。

小结

在GitHub上下载二进制文件是一个简单而直观的过程,通过本文的指导,相信您可以顺利找到并下载所需的二进制文件。无论您是开发者还是用户,都可以从中受益。请注意,始终确保所下载文件的来源和安全性,以避免潜在的风险。希望本篇文章能对您有所帮助!

正文完